TEHRAN (Tasnim) – President of the Vietnamese National Assembly’s Commission of Science, Technology and Environment is scheduled to pay an official visit to Tehran this week to hold talks with senior Iranian lawmakers and officials.

Heading a parliamentary delegation, Phan Xuan Dung will arrive in the Iranian capital on August 25.

During the 5-day visit, the Vietnamese lawmakers are planned to sit down with members of the country’s Parliament (Majlis) Education and Research Commission as well as Energy Commission.

Xuan Dung and his accompanying mission will hold meetings with officials of Environmental Protection Organization as well.

Iran’s parliament has in recent months intensified measures to strengthen ties with parliaments of the other countries after Tehran and the Group 5+1 (Russia, China, the US, Britain, France and Germany) on July 14, 2015 reached a conclusion over the text of a comprehensive 159-page deal on Tehran’s nuclear program and started implementing it on January 16.

The comprehensive nuclear deal, known as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action (JCPOA), terminated all nuclear-related sanctions imposed on Iran.
